Abstract
A thermostatic device particularly usable in sensing the surface tempoerature of a rotatable member in a fuser includes a rotatable roller mountable in rolling engagement with a moving surface. A heat sensor located inside the roller senses temperature variations in the roller. For example, a pin that is spring-urged against the inside surface of the roller, moves a switch between open and closed conditions as the inside diameter of the roller varies with a change in its temperature. Alternatively, a bimetallic disc positioned in engagement with the inside surface of the roller is sensed to open or close a switch in response to the roller temperature reaching a given threshold.
